where could i have placed the secondskin to cause this problem? the weather stripping is compltely fine not torn or ripped anywhere.. ideas?

 
How close to the trunk gasket/seal are you? As a rule of thumb, I would recommend staying 1 to 2 inches away from that gasket when deadening. It looks like you are right on it from the photo, but, I could totally be wrong.
